Compartilhar via


FLOOR

aplica-se a:coluna calculadatabela calculadaMeasurecálculo visual

Arredonda um número para baixo, em direção a zero, para o múltiplo mais próximo de significância.

Sintaxe

FLOOR(<number>, <significance>)

Parâmetros

Prazo Definição
number O value numérico que você deseja round.
significance O múltiplo ao qual você deseja round. Os argumentosnumberandsignificance devem ser positivos, or ambos são negativos.

Retornar value

Um número decimal.

Observações

  • If um dos argumentos não é numérico, FLOOR retorna #VALUE!errorvalue.

  • If número and significância têm sinais diferentes, FLOOR retorna o #NUM!errorvalue.

  • Independentemente da sign do número, um value é arredondado para baixo quando ajustado para longe de zero. If o número é um exact múltiplo de significância, nenhum arredondamento ocorre.

  • Essa função not tem suporte para uso no modo DirectQuery quando usada em colunas calculadas or regras de RLS (segurança em nível de linha).

Exemplo

A fórmula a seguir usa o values na coluna [Custo total Product] da tabela, InternetSales, and arredonda para baixo até o múltiplo mais próximo de .1.

= FLOOR(InternetSales[Total Product Cost],.1)

A tabela a seguir mostra os resultados esperados para alguns samplevalues:

Values Resultado esperado
10.8423 10.8
8.0373 8
2.9733 2.9

Funções de and de matemática